How to Extract Key Data & Metrics from Annual Reports
Extract Key Insights (AI)The Problem
Annual reports from publicly traded companies often run 50–100+ pages, packed with financial data, strategic commentary, and risk disclosures. Investors, analysts, and business students spend hours hunting for the metrics that matter — revenue growth, margin trends, forward guidance, and risk factors. Missing a key figure means making decisions with incomplete data.
